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Nuremberg to Mayen is to bus which costs €23 - €40 and takes 7h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Nuremberg to Mayen is to drive which takes 3h 2m and costs €50 - €75.
No, there is no direct bus from Nuremberg station to Mayen. However, there are services departing from Nuremberg central bus station and arriving at Mayen Brückentor via Koblenz Hauptbahnhof.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 58m.
The distance between Nuremberg and Mayen is 387 km. The road distance is 365.1 km.
The best way to get from Nuremberg to Mayen without a car is to train and line 350 bus which takes 5h 36m and costs .
It takes approximately 5h 36m to get from Nuremberg to Mayen, including transfers.
Nuremberg to Mayen b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Nuremberg central bus station.
Nuremberg to Mayen b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Coblenz central train station.
Yes, the driving distance between Nuremberg to Mayen is 365 km. It takes approximately 3h 2m to drive from Nuremberg to Mayen.
